Adjustable virtual network performance
First Claim
1. A method for managing cloud computing resources performed by data processing apparatus, the method comprising:
- receiving a plurality of user-specified parameter values including values for storage size and input/output performance parameters for a virtual disk instance;
generating one or more virtual disk instances having the user-specified parameter values;
monitoring usage of the one or more virtual disk instances;
determining that the monitored usage of the one or more virtual disk instances satisfies a threshold;
in response to determining that the monitored usage of the one or more virtual disk instances satisfies the threshold, determining two or more modified parameter values that result in a lower price than a price determined based on the corresponding two or more user-specified parameter values; and
updating the corresponding two or more user-specified parameter values with the two or more modified parameter values.

Abstract
Methods, systems, and apparatus, including computer programs encoded on a computer storage medium, relating to managing resources. In one aspect, a method includes the actions of receiving configuration information, the configuration information specifying a plurality of parameter values including values for a size and input/output performance parameters, where the size and performance parameters are independently specified by a user; determining one or more physical resources that satisfy the received configuration information; and generating one or more virtual disk instances having the specified size and performance parameters.
